What Is a Urine Drug Screen?

In Minburn, IA, a urine drug screen (UDS) serves as a crucial diagnostic technique that examines a urine sample to identify drugs and their byproducts. This technique stands out as the most prevalent testing method within workplace and regulated environments, primarily because it is non-invasive, economically viable, and capable of detecting a vast array of substances across an effective detection window.

  • For regulated testing, adherence to chain-of-custody protocols during collection is mandatory.
  • The test identifies both the original drugs and/or their metabolites excreted in the urine.
  • It signifies previous substance exposure within a discernible detection window but does not reveal current intoxication levels.

Why Organizations Use Urine Drug Screening

  • In Minburn, IA, pre-employment drug testing ensures the maintenance of a secure and drug-free workplace environment.
  • Testing can occur randomly, post-accident, based on reasonable suspicion, or when an employee is returning to duty.
  • Ensures adherence to legal requirements within industries where safety is crucial.
  • Helps in tracking compliance with prescribed medications or rehabilitation programs.

How It Works

Collection

  • In Minburn, IA, the donor is required to provide a urine specimen kept in a secured container, aligning with the rules of the specific program observed or unobserved.
  • To ensure specimen integrity, various checks might be conducted, including tests for creatinine levels, specific gravity, and pH balance.

Detection Windows

Substance detection varies by drug type, usage frequency, metabolic rate, hydration, body composition, and test sensitivity. Typically, many drugs can be found for 1–3 days post-consumption, although extended detection can occur with substances like cannabinoids in habitual users.

What Is a Hair Drug Screen?

In Minburn, IA, hair follicle drug testing is an advanced method employed to analyze a minor hair sample from an individual. This test detects drug presence and their metabolites that have circulated in the bloodstream and are embedded within the hair shaft. Due to the slow growth of hair, it retains drug metabolites for an extended duration, offering one of the most extended detection windows, ideally suited for identifying prolonged or habitual substance use.

  • The process generally involves collecting 100–120 strands trimmed close to the scalp, approximately 1.5 inches in length.
  • This length typically represents a detection period of about 90 days, although the exact period may vary depending on hair growth.
  • A wide array of substances including amphetamines, opioids, cocaine, cannabis, and PCP can be detected through this testing method.

Why Organizations Use Hair Drug Screening

  • In Minburn, IA, pre-employment assessments aimed at identifying long-term substance use.
  • Utilization within random or periodical workplace testing programs in sectors sensitive to safety concerns.
  • Ensuring adherence within treatment regimes or legal accountability settings.
  • Verification regarding lifestyle abstinence or alignment with organizational drug-free policies.

How It Works

Collection

  • In Minburn, IA, a sample is usually collected from the crown area by a qualified collector following established chain-of-custody protocols.
  • The gathered sample is promptly sealed, labeled, and sent to a certified laboratory for analysis.
  • If scalp hair isn't available, body hair may serve as an alternate source for sampling.

Testing Methodology

  • In Minburn, IA laboratories, samples are prepped by washing to eliminate external contaminants.
  • Initial testing employs immunoassay techniques to identify broad drug classes.
  • If a positive indication arises, confirmatory testing, such as GC/MS or LC/MS/MS, is employed for precise identification.
  • Cutoff levels, expressed in nanograms per milligram (ng/mg), align with SAMHSA and laboratory criteria.

Interpreting Results

  • Negative: Indicates no drugs or metabolites detected above laboratory-set thresholds, implying no prolonged exposure.
  • Positive: Drugs/metabolites are identified and then verified through subsequent testing indicating prior substance interaction.
  • Inconclusive/Rejected: A sample deemed inadequate or tainted necessitates retesting for a clear evaluation.

Detection Windows

In Minburn, IA, hair testing offers the longest detection capability among drug testing methods. A standard 1.5-inch hair sample provides insights into approximately 90 days of drug exposure potential. Longer hair may extend the detection potential further, contingent on hair growth rates, typically about 0.5 inches per month. Unlike urine or oral fluid tests, hair analysis does not detect drugs used in the last 7–10 days.

Key Considerations for Hair Drug Testing in Minburn, IA

  • Current DOT guidelines have not mandated hair testing, but evaluation for future implementation is underway by both DOT and HHS.
  • For non-DOT applications, hair testing is recognized as a robust long-term detection method.
  • Collection should be undertaken by skilled personnel maintaining strict chain-of-custody documentation.
  • Laboratories engaged should have SAMHSA or CAP/CLIA certifications to assure test accuracy and reliability.

Benefits

  • Extended detection timeline up to or exceeding 90 days.
  • Minimal risk for adulteration or substitution compared to urine samples.
  • Reveals patterns of continuous or recurrent drug use.
  • The collection process is swift, non-intrusive, and doesn't necessitate bathroom facilities.
